First Colored Souvenir Coin on 'Panchtantra' Inaugurated

  • Finance Minister Nirmala Sitharaman has launched the first colour souvenir coin on 'Panchtantra' on the occasion of the 17th foundation day of Security Printing and Minting Corporation of India Limited (SPMCIL).
  • Ms. Tripti Patra Ghosh, CMD, SPMCIL, in her welcome address, highlighted the achievements and the innovative initiatives of the Company.
  • During the occasion, the Chief General Managers of the respective 09 Units awarded the meritorious employees for their outstanding achievements.
